From Jen and Alexis Luhrs, creators of the popular Streaming Colors Fitness Journal monthly "healthy habit-forming calendar" (since 2004), and of Lean Mode, Color Code-Not Your Usual Food Diary (2008), comes this handy weekly fitness planner featuring a week of color-in modules on each page with additional lined space to write in daily food and workout details or appointments. As with the Streaming Colors monthly calendar version, the main idea is to color in the daily modules with each day's positive actions, such as exercising, drinking more water, eating more veggies, or having a junk-food-free day. Color helps remind, reward and motivate you to practice a healthy action long enough for it to become a habit you hardly have to think about (like taking a shower in the morning.) Healthy habits feel comfortable and normal-unlike torturous diets and exercise regimens you can't wait to quit-and are the key to better fitness and a healthier lifestyle! Since color is the key, this journal features an energizing change of background color each month throughout its 12-month, perfect-bound 80 pages (full-color, laminated paperback cover, 8.5 x 8.5 inches square). In addition to 52 weekly planner pages, it includes helpful information on getting started, setting goals and rewards, rating your health and fitness before and after, pages for coloring in special achievements or milestones, monthly tips for beginning and advanced exercising, and the occasional motivational saying. Includes a Food Diary Worksheet and pages for recording info on your favorite foods and activities. To help you stay on track and improve all year long, there is a color key you customize at the start of each month with the healthy actions you wish to focus on, along with a goal and reward area. Using highlighters, you color in your positive actions each day. Coloring is an instant reward for healthy choices. Patterns of color indicate your progress even if physical results aren't yet showing. A lack of color is a reminder and motivator to get back on track. Over time, a build-up of color is a reminder of your ability to take control of your habits. The Streaming Colors Fitness Journal Weekly Planner was created and authored by Jen and Alexis Luhrs, a mom/daughter publishing/creative team that has had a lifelong devotion to healthy eating habits and preventive health. Mom, Jennifer, is a health/medical copywriter/creative director who worked with the Stanford Prevention Research Center to develop the HealthBuzz web site that was co-branded with msnbc.com in 1997. She wrote the content of the original Streaming Colors Fitness Journal based on established principles of health behavior change, and Dr. Wes Alles, Director of the Health Improvement Program at Stanford University, reviewed the journal's written content to ensure that it is sound. Calling on their backgrounds in Industrial Design and Architecture, respectively, Jennifer and Alexis created the journal's color-coded daily tracking system to be intuitive and adaptable, but most of all, easy and fun to use. Studies show that journaling is the key to long term weight loss success. The Streaming Colors Fitness Journal combines the power of journaling with the fun of coloring. Developed by the National Strength and Conditioning Association (NSCA) and now in its fourth edition, Essentials of Strength Training and Conditioning is the essential text for strength and conditioning professionals and students. This comprehensive resource, created by 30 expert contributors in the field, explains the key theories, concepts, and scientific principles of strength training and conditioning as well as their direct application to athletic competition and performance. The scope and content of Essentials of Strength Training and Conditioning, Fourth Edition With HKPropel Access, have been updated to convey the knowledge, skills, and abilities required of a strength and conditioning professional and to address the latest information found on the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ist (CSCS) exam. The evidence-based approach and unbeatable accuracy of the text make it the primary resource to rely on for CSCS exam preparation. The text is organized to lead readers from theory to program design and practical strategies for administration and management of strength and conditioning facilities. The fourth edition contains the most current research and applications and several new features: Online videos featuring 21 resistance training exercises demonstrate proper exercise form for classroom and practical use. Updated research—specifically in the areas of high-intensity interval training, overtraining, agility and change of direction, nutrition for health and performance, and periodization—helps readers better understand these popular trends in the industry. A new chapter with instructions and photos presents techniques for exercises using alternative modes and nontraditional implements. Ten additional tests, including those for maximum strength, power, and aerobic capacity, along with new flexibility exercises, resistance training exercises, plyometric exercises, and speed and agility drills help professionals design programs that reflect current guidelines. Key points, chapter objectives, and learning aids including key terms and self-study questions provide a structure to help students and professionals conceptualize the information and reinforce fundamental facts. Application sidebars provide practical application of scientific concepts that can be used by strength and conditioning specialists in real-world settings, making the information immediately relatable and usable. Online learning tools delivered through HKPropel provide students with 11 downloadable lab activities for practice and retention of information. Further, both students and professionals will benefit from the online videos of 21 foundational exercises that provide visual instruction and reinforce proper technique. Essentials of Strength Training and Conditioning, Fourth Edition, provides the most comprehensive information on organization and administration of facilities, testing and evaluation, exercise techniques, training adaptations, program design, and structure and function of body systems. Its scope, precision, and dependability make it the essential preparation text for the CSCS exam as well as a definitive reference for strength and conditioning professionals to consult in their everyday practice.
